The original Cave of the Winds was located behind the Bridal Veil Falls (the smallest of the three Niagara Falls). Visitors could explore the cave and view the Falls from this unique and breathtaking vantage point. The cave was, however, destroyed by rock fall in 1920 – but the chance for an up-close encounter with Niagara Falls still remains!
Today, the Cave of the Winds tour lets you venture up to the front of the base of the Bridal Veil Falls where the pounding water creates exhilarating tropical storm conditions.
You take a 175-foot elevator ride down to the base of the Falls where you are provided with a yellow souvenir poncho and special sandals. Now you can safely venture out on to the redwood walkways and platforms that take you to within 20 feet of the Falls!
The walkways are removed each autumn so that they are not damaged by the winter weather. Seasonal tickets to the Cave of the Winds let you visit the area to watch the decking being erected again for the next tour season. Watch as skilled workmen wedge the wooden support beams securely into the crevices of the rocks and position the walkway atop them.

Maid of the Mist
Journey right up to the Falls’ crashing foam on a famed Maid of the Mist tour. Feel the mist from the Falls against your face while you wear a complimentary blue poncho from the boat’s crew to protect your clothing. This popular tour operates during the spring and summer when the weather at the Falls is at its finest!

Skylon Tower
See Niagara Falls in its entirety from the top of the 775-foot high Skylon Tower. You can enjoy a delicious meal at the Revolving Dining Room restaurant while you take in the awesome panoramic view of the Falls.

Visit the Three Falls
Some Niagara Falls tours will take you to the three distinct falls that make up this natural wonder – the thunderous Horseshoe Falls; the W-shaped and slowly eroding American Falls; and the Bridal Veil Falls where the Cave of the Winds is located.
